Who is the training for?
OutoftheBox is an approach that can be used by those working with children, adults and intergenerational groups in schools, hospitals, churches, families, care homes, prisons or in the community. It is a useful approach for those involved in mentoring, chaplaincy, therapy, counselling and spiritual accompaniment. It is also used by those working to improve the working culture of secular and faith organisations.

OutoftheBox can be done anywhere with anything (eg leaves and twigs in a wood, glasses and beer mats on a pub table). This training can be done without buying any materials although you may wish to purchase these resources which will enable you to share all the 49 wisdom stories.
